About the Gdansk — Newcastle upon Tyne flight

You can book flights from Gdansk to Newcastle upon Tyne on this page. The flight covers a distance of 1,305 km and usually operates once a week.

The main carrier on this route is LS. Since ticket prices change constantly, we recommend using the low-fare calendar to find the best deals. Before your trip, check out the information on how to get to the airport in Gdansk and how to get from the airport in Newcastle to the city center.

When to fly

The climate in Newcastle upon Tyne is most favorable in July, when average highs reach 19°C. The coldest month is January, with a minimum temperature of 2.2°C, while rainfall peaks in October.

From a budget perspective, it's best to plan your flight for November, when ticket prices start $106. Prices peak in September—flights during this period will cost $224.

July is the optimal choice for a balance of weather and cost: tickets start $116 during the most comfortable temperatures. It is advisable to avoid traveling in September due to the seasonal price hike.

Frequently asked questions about the Gdansk — Newcastle upon Tyne flight

How long is the flight from Gdansk to Newcastle upon Tyne?

A direct flight covering 1,305 km takes about 2 hours and 15 minutes on average.

Which airlines fly from Gdansk to Newcastle upon Tyne?

The main carrier operating regular flights on this route is LS.

Are there direct flights on this route?

Yes, direct flights are available, though they operate at a low frequency—approximately once a week.

How much is the cheapest ticket?

Ticket prices are dynamic and depend on the departure date. You can see the current minimum price in the low-fare calendar on this page.

Which airport does the flight arrive at?

All flights from Gdansk arrive at Newcastle International Airport (NCL).
